What's The Definition Of Bourgeon?
[v] produce buds, branches, or germinate; of plants
Synonyms | Synonyms for Bourgeon: burgeon forth | germinate | pullulate | shoot | sprout | spud Related Terms | Find terms related to Bourgeon: See Also | grow Bourgeon In Webster's Dictionary \Bour"geon\, v. i. [OE. burjoun a bud, burjounen to
bud, F. bourgeon a bud, bourgeonner to bud; cf. OHG. burjan
to raise.]
To sprout; to put forth buds; to shoot forth, as a branch.
Gayly to bourgeon and broadly to grow. --Sir W.
Scott.
